Yongduam (Dragon Head) rock in Jeju Island

The rock was created by unusual lava formation plus strong winds and waves over thousands of years. Its shape looked like a roaring Dragon rising from the sea into the sky. There were lots of stories of how it came to be like that.

Jeju Dongmun traditional wet market in Jeju Island

Oh!  I love this place! It's a market where people selling meat, vegetables, fishes, seafood,  fruits and so on.

Selling local products and souvenirs - Dongmun market

Other than that, local products were also sold here. The famous Hallabong orange,  chocolate fruits, rice wine, honey,  snacks made of the orange, souvenirs and so on. Lots of shops sold same things with almost the same price. Interesting!

Korean local snacks ^^

We both were hungry. Just nice there was a shop selling local snacks and they offered seat too. We decided to eat there. We ordered each type of the snack's menu available but 'mangdu' or dumplings were sold out. Oh, it tasted so good! Spicy rice cake or tteokboki,  seaweed rice rolls or kimbab, fish cake stick or odeng, tempura fried chili and sotong or cuttlefish,  sausage rice with pig's liver and intestines. It really filled our stomach up! All costs KRW 9,500 or $S11.60.
